Output d909581131e2e13da83c2d06b1ee2d0da4d77bc06a7c78876eb75bd778e6459d:1

value
13521821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084981170e81ed3711605bacfd09542d3bf1871c OP_EQUAL
address
32SqPF6LWF36w1BrdiekdZcRDFrZy4UzMS
transaction
d909581131e2e13da83c2d06b1ee2d0da4d77bc06a7c78876eb75bd778e6459d
spent
true